New Delhi: Have you ever shopped online? Well, in this age of digital market, online shopping is a norm everywhere. But, have you heard of online sperm shopping? A recent report suggests that Chinese men are selling off their sperms online through a shopping site.

According to a report published in Times Of India, shopping site Taobao is paying off the donors a sum of $500-$700 for the service. This global trade website is owned by Alibaba and has plenty of bizarre sounding offers in their list for the probable customers. Report further states that the site also offers soaps made of breast milk.

The site offering sperm donation has reportedly attracted over 22,000 replies in just 48 hours for the same. At a time when China is facing the problem of infertility, which is on a rise in the country—this move might be seen as a boon in disguise for many.
